North Whitehall, PA (August 4, 2025) – An injury crash at the intersection of Mauch Chunk Rd and Cedar Crest Blvd on Sunday afternoon prompted a two-medic-unit response and involved multiple fire departments from the area. The collision occurred in North Whitehall Township and was confirmed to involve multiple injured individuals.
Emergency crews from Fire Stations 26 and 22 were dispatched to the scene along with EMS personnel. Due to the severity of the crash and the number of patients involved, a second medic unit was requested shortly after initial responders arrived. Paramedics provided on-site care and began transporting victims to area hospitals. The exact number of injured parties and the nature of their injuries have not yet been released.
The intersection was partially blocked as responders stabilized the scene and cleared damaged vehicles. Authorities have not confirmed the number of vehicles involved, though reports indicate a significant impact and multiple occupants needing medical assistance.
An investigation is underway to determine the cause of the crash, and contributing factors such as driver error, speed, or visibility are being examined by law enforcement.
